Man who thought he won $238 million Powerball loses dispute against Lottoland

Another case of mistaken lotteries has left a man who thought he had won $238 million empty-handed following a dispute over deceptive conduct.It’s the second time the major international gambling provider Lottoland has been challenged after a woman, referred to as Ms B, earlier this year claimed she held a ticket for the $126 million US Powerball prize.
But she had actually entered another jackpot drawn on the same day as the Powerball advertised with a similar logo, known as the THU Jackpot.
